titleOfInvention |
Method of dyeing cellulosic substrates |
abstract |
The present invention is related to methods for dyeing a traveling cellulosic substrate. The methods include steps of cationizing a cellulosic substrate followed by applying foam including one or more dyes to the cationized cellulosic substrate. |
